A presentation by Laura Irvine, on technological and privacy challenges in the COVID-19 era.
Laura is Head of Regulatory Law and Partner at Davidson Chalmers Stewart LLP, a Criminal Solicitor Advocate and accredited by the Law Society of Scotland as a Specialist in Freedom of Information and Data Protection Law.
Her ‘claim to fame’ is that she was part of the only legal team in the UK to have successfully overturned a fine imposed by the ICO under the Data Protection Act 1998.
As a specialist data protection lawyer, Laura has provided data protection and information law advice to a wide variety of clients, in varying sectors and of all shapes and sizes – both public and private sector.
She wrote the Law Society of Scotland’s Guide to the GDPR and is a co-founder of PODs (Protectors of Data Scotland) the pre-eminent group of data protection enthusiasts in Scotland.
She is also a board member of the Scottish Business Resilience Centre which works with Government, Police and other public sector bodies to assist the private sector in Scotland to remain resilient
